Advantages of Using an Exercise Cycle
Exercise cycles supply a wide variety of advantages, making them an exceptional option for both beginners and experienced professional athletes. Below is a detailed list of these benefits:
| Benefit | Description |
|---|---|
| Low Impact Exercise | Unlike running or other high-impact activities, cycling places less pressure on the joints, making it appropriate for individuals with joint issues or injuries. |
| Cardiovascular Health | Regular biking improves heart health by enhancing the heart muscle, lowering high blood pressure, and increasing total endurance. |
| Muscle Tone and Strength | Biking works major muscle groups, including the quadriceps, hamstrings, glutes, and calves, assisting to tone and enhance these areas. |
| Weight Management | An effective tool for burning calories, biking can aid with weight reduction when combined with a well balanced diet plan. |
| Convenience | An exercise cycle can be utilized inside your home, permitting workouts no matter climate condition. |
| Versatility | Many exercise cycles feature adjustable resistance levels, making them ideal for users of all physical fitness levels, from beginners to innovative bicyclists. |
| Mental Health Benefits | Exercise releases endorphins, which can lower tension and promote a positive state of mind. Regular cycling can assist enhance mental wellness. |
| Home entertainment Options | Numerous modern exercise cycles come equipped with Bluetooth speakers, screens for streaming, or apps for interactive exercises, making working out more satisfying. |
Types of Exercise Cycles
Exercise cycles been available in various styles and designs, each accommodating various preferences and exercise routines. Here are the main types:
1. Upright Bikes
- Description: Similar to a standard bicycle, users preserve an upright position.
- Best For: Users wanting to replicate outdoor biking and focusing on cardiovascular fitness.
2. Recumbent Bikes
- Description: These bikes have a bigger seat and back support, permitting users to sit in a reclined position.
- Best For: Those seeking convenience, people with back issues, and older adults.
3. Spin Bikes
- Description: Designed for high-intensity workouts, spin bikes usually have a heavier flywheel and enable diverse standing positions.
- Best For: Fitness enthusiasts who take pleasure in spin classes or high-performance cycling.
4. Folding Bikes
- Description: Compact designs that can be folded for storage, ideal for those with limited space.
- Best For: Apartment residents or anybody searching for a portable exercise alternative.
| Kind Of Exercise Cycle | Secret Features | Pros | Cons |
|---|---|---|---|
| Upright Bike | Light-weight, compact | Mimics outdoor biking | Less comfortable |
| Recumbent Bike | Larger seat, back assistance | Comfortable for long trips | Uses up more area |
| Spin Bike | Heavy flywheel | Intense workouts, adjustable resistance | Not always comfy |
| Folding Bike | Space-saving style | Portable, easy to keep | May lack stability in some designs |
Choosing the Right Exercise Cycle
Picking the best exercise cycle depends on specific preferences, exercise goals, and budget plan. Here are some aspects to think about:
- Space Availability: Determine the space you have for your exercise cycle. If you have actually limited area, consider a folding bike.
- Workout Goals: Are you looking for a low-intensity exercise or something more extreme? If you choose high-intensity training, a spin bike may be the very best alternative.
- Budget: Exercise cycles come in different cost ranges. Set a budget plan and try to find designs that meet your requirements without exceeding it.
- Comfort: Test out various types of bikes to find one that feels comfortable. Try to find designs with adjustable seats and handlebars.
- Functions: Consider additional features such as heart rate displays, Bluetooth connectivity, and integrated workout programs.

Safety and Considerations
While exercise cycles are generally safe for most users, there are some crucial pointers to bear in mind to guarantee optimal safety:
- Proper Setup: Adjust the seat height so that your knees are slightly bent at the bottom of the pedal stroke.
- Warm-Up and Cool Down: Always start with a warm-up and end with a cool off to avoid injury.
- Stay Hydrated: Drink water before, throughout, and after your workout to remain hydrated.
- Listen to Your Body: If you feel any pain, stop and assess your type. Speak with an expert if essential.
